In article <20030912182216.GK27368@fs.tum.de>,
Adrian Bunk <bunk@fs.tum.de> wrote:
[...]

| But even CONFIG_X86_GENERIC doesn't do what you expect. A kernel
| compiled for Athlon wouldn't run on a Pentium 4 even with
| CONFIG_X86_GENERIC.
|
| Quoting arch/i386/Kconfig in -test5:
|
| <-- snip -->
|
| config X86_USE_3DNOW
| bool
| depends on MCYRIXIII || MK7
| default y
|
| <-- snip -->
|
| My patch in the mail
|
| RFC: [2.6 patch] better i386 CPU selection
|
| tries to solve these problem with a different approach (the user selects
| all CPUs he wants to support).

If you have managed to work around all the conflicting capabilities
without leaving the kernel way suboptimal on some, I salute your better
solution.
